1. African Nations Starting With R
In Africa, you’ll find two nations that start with «R»: the Republic of Congo and Rwanda.
Republic of Congo
- Best Time to Visit: May to September
- Highlights: Odzala-Kokoua National Park, Pointe Noire’s coastal beauty, and the cultural richness of Brazzaville.
Despite its challenges, the Republic of Congo is making strides in tourism, especially with the upcoming First World Music and Tourism Festival in Kinshasa.
Rwanda
- Best Time to Visit: June to September and December to February
- Highlights: Nyungwe National Park, Kigali Genocide Memorial, and stunning landscapes.
Rwanda is on a mission to enhance its tourism sector, aiming to double visitor numbers by 2028. With its natural beauty and cultural depth, it’s a destination worth exploring.
2. European Countries Starting With R
Moving to Europe, two important nations begin with «R»: Romania and Russia.
Romania
- Best Time to Visit: May to June and September to October
- Highlights: Bucharest, the historic town of Sighișoara, and the breathtaking Carpathian Mountains.
Romania is witnessing a surge in tourism, thanks in part to improved connectivity through airlines like FLYYO.
Russia
- Best Time to Visit: June to August and September to October
- Highlights: St. Petersburg, Moscow, and the serene Lake Baikal.
With an evolving tourism landscape, Russia is embracing new technologies to attract both domestic and international visitors.
3. The Only Asian Country Starting With R
In Asia, the Republic of Korea stands out as the sole nation starting with «R.»
Republic of Korea
- Best Time to Visit: April to May and September to October
- Highlights: N Seoul Tower, Gyeongbokgung Palace, and Gamcheon Culture Village.
South Korea is actively seeking to boost its tourism through international partnerships, making it an increasingly popular destination.
